Output 7ffd70ef180da143ec9f42ee45b3632458e3a24bea27cd814e23574b1507801a:0

value
352915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 445c983d24476fa8260e20d5779d35f323a4429b OP_EQUALVERIFY OP_CHECKSIG
address
17ETsdsvieWu7YLVgppPWvAQm5CLDsKDZW
transaction
7ffd70ef180da143ec9f42ee45b3632458e3a24bea27cd814e23574b1507801a
confirmations
257665
spent
true